Chhota Damodarpur
Chhota Damodarpur is a village located in Kushmundi subdivision of Dakshin Dinajpur district in West Bengal, India. It is situated 13.7km away from sub-district headquarter Kushmundi (tehsildar office) and 83.2km away from district headquarter Balurghat. As per 2009 stats, Maligaon is the gram panchayat of Chhota Damodarpur village.

About Chhota Damodarpur
According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Chhota Damodarpur is 310486. The village spans a total geographical area of 147.28 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 733121. Kaliagong is nearest town to Chhota Damodarpur village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 10km away.

Population of Chhota Damodarpur
According to the 2011 Census, Chhota Damodarpur has a total population of about 922, with approximately 460 males and 462 females. The sex ratio is around 1004 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 96 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 280 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. The Scheduled Tribes (ST) population includes 1 person. The overall literacy rate is approximately 61.39%, with male literacy at about 66.30% and female literacy near 56.49%. There are around 233 households in the village. Connectivity of Chhota Damodarpur
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Chhota Damodarpur. As per the 2011 stats, Chhota Damodarpur had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
Connectivity Type | Status (in year 2011) |
---|---|
Public Bus Service | Available within <5 km distance |
Private Bus Service | Available within <5 km distance |
Railway Station | Available within 10+ km distance |
